True! I will wait patiently and see what comes up.Is it possible that he might not know what he has and who ever bought the car new took it over to dana and had the 396 traded for 427 and no documentation was recorded.

Unreal 12-18-2003 03:42 PM

Re: copo on ebay real or not??
 
Mark, anything's possible, but it's highly unlikely. If that were the case, it would most certainly have a CE coded block, not the MO block he claims. It's possible that that motor was removed from a 69 COPO and transplanted into the 68, 20 years ago, but I doubt that gives it any more value than doing it last week. Just my opinion.
